Output 844ac10faf2f24c71f433837417d34a6b87a36d24c8a9d713f0175c74c9e541b:2

value
2369180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989641be15151cd0a65e1998e4cc0f55808aae63 OP_EQUAL
address
3FbpdjB1pCbYdn1Z2xzMXhjCCq7iuxPRPX
transaction
844ac10faf2f24c71f433837417d34a6b87a36d24c8a9d713f0175c74c9e541b
confirmations
257686
spent
true